Abstract


Employee productivity is one of the important factors in the progress of the company, to measure productivity time and motion methods are used and a dashboard is needed to review the level of employee productivity. Making dashboards manually takes a long time, while stakeholders need progressive and fast information. So a digital dashboard prototype design was made to meet user needs, then a research method focused on user needs, namely Design Thinking. The stages of this method are empathize, define, ideate, prototype, and test. The implementation of this method begins with interviewing potential users with questions that can explore user needs and direct observation, the answers of potential users will be analyzed so that they are properly defined, and problems that are defined will be given solution ideas that meet user needs, solution ideas will be applied as a digital dashboard prototype design and will be tested to test the prototype using usability testing to determine the effectiveness and efficiency of the prototype made. From the steps carried out to produce conclusions such as defined problems, solution ideas are obtained that are applied to the prototype, with the previously designed image making it easier to work on the prototype design and the test results proving that the prototype that has been designed is effective and efficient, the level of completion of the task carried out. the tester got a perfect score with a 100% success rate and a relatively fast task completion speed.
